Harness club seeks new home for giant marquee

STAWELL Harness Racing Club is inviting offers for its enormous trackside marquee, as the club moves on from an ambitious project from a previous era and looks to refocus on harness racing. The steel-framed marquee, which measures about 65 metres by 25 metres, has stood in the middle of the Stawell track for several years and has been used for events including the Stawell Show.
